ATV Nature Ride and Sunset Tour at Ricks Cafe from Montego Bay

Montego Bay’s ATV Nature Ride and Sunset Tour at Ricks Cafe offers a fascinating mix of adventure, scenic beauty, and Caribbean culture. For $135, you get about 7 to 8 hours of fun, including transportation, guided ATV riding through mountains and farms, and a memorable visit to the famous Ricks Cafe for sunset viewing and cliff jumping. The tour is ideal for those who love outdoor adventures combined with opportunities to relax and enjoy Jamaica’s legendary sunsets.

What we love about this tour is the way it balances active exploration with cultural insights. Riding through lush mountain trails and small village farms offers a genuine feel of Jamaica’s natural environment and rural life, all with expert guidance. Plus, the visit to Ricks Cafe—famous for its breathtaking cliff views and lively atmosphere—provides a perfect end to the day, whether you choose to jump, watch the sunset, or simply soak in the scenic beauty with a cold Red Stripe in hand.

A possible consideration is the timing—this tour is quite full and long, which might be tiring for some travelers, especially if you’re not accustomed to outdoor activities or if you prefer a more relaxed pace. Also, while the tour includes stops for photos and snacks, there’s no included lunch, so you may want to plan for a meal either before or after.

Starting Point: Missile Adventure Park and Safety First

Your day begins with a convenient pickup from your hotel or AirBnB in Montego Bay, a huge plus for travelers wanting to skip the hassle of arranging transport. Upon arrival at Missile Adventure Park, you’ll receive a quick safety briefing from your guide, which is vital for ensuring everyone feels comfortable, especially if it’s your first time on an ATV. We appreciated the demonstration of ATV riding techniques — it’s reassuring and helps newbies gain confidence.

The guide, often local and friendly, will take you through a brief overview of Jamaica’s geography and highlights of what you’re about to experience. Fitting into helmets and sitting on your ATV, you’re ready to go. The initial ride is about getting comfortable, but soon you’ll be revving up through the stunning mountains and lush landscape, feeling the warm Caribbean breeze.

Mountain Trails and Panoramic Views

What makes this trail special is the variety. You’ll cruise through small farming communities and picturesque countryside, giving you a real taste of rural Jamaica. Riders will love the moments splashing through puddles and roaring up slopes, which add excitement and plenty of fun. The highlight? Reaching a mountain viewpoint at 2,200 feet (670 meters)—from here, the views are stunning. We loved the chance to capture some spectacular photos of the rolling hills, farmlands, and distant ocean, which make for great souvenirs.

Tour guides are knowledgeable and share stories about local life, farming, and the landscape’s history. The ride lasts roughly an hour, but the feeling of freedom and connection with nature makes it feel longer in the best way. It’s an active, engaging way to see Jamaica’s natural beauty beyond the beaches.

Stop at Rick’s Cafe: Sunset and Cliff Jumping

After the ATV adventure, the tour heads to the famous Rick’s Cafe in Negril—a laid-back spot renowned for its dramatic cliffside setting and spectacular sunsets. The journey from the mountains to the coast is part of the charm, providing a quick change from lush greenery to ocean vistas.

At Rick’s Cafe, you can simply watch the sunset, sip a refreshing drink, or get adventurous with cliff jumping. The iconic 35-foot (11-meter) ledge is thrilling, and many visitors find themselves eager to leap into the turquoise waters below. For those less inclined or with safety concerns, just soaking in the sunset with a cold Red Stripe beer from the bar is a worthy experience. We appreciated the lively, relaxed atmosphere, where reggae music and friendly chatter fill the air.

The sunset itself is often described as breathtaking—a perfect moment to reflect on a day packed with adventure. If you’re lucky, you’ll catch the sky turning fiery shades of orange and pink, making it an ideal photo opportunity. The vibe here is fun and spirited, suitable for all ages, and you might find yourself dancing or enjoying some local snacks.

What’s Included and What’s Not?

The tour provides bottled water, private transportation, air-conditioned vehicle, and hotel/AirBnB pickup and drop-off, which makes logistics simple. The price covers all fees and taxes, ensuring no surprises. While lunch isn’t included, the stops for snacks or meals are at your own expense, so plan accordingly.
